The Kotara Grampanchayat is an administrative unit in the state of Chhattisgarh, located in the Baramkela Tehsil of Sarangarh-bilaigarh District. This page provides comprehensive details about the Grampanchayat, its wards, population, and the villages under its jurisdiction.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What is Kotara Gram Panchayat and where is it located?

Kotara Gram Panchayat is a local administrative body located in Baramkela Tehsil, Sarangarh-bilaigarh District, Chhattisgarh, India.

2. How many people live in Kotara Gram Panchayat according to the Census 2011?

As per the Census 2011, the total population of Kotara Gram Panchayat is 1504. Out of this, 1006 are literate and 498 are illiterate.

3. Who is the current Sarpanch of Kotara Gram Panchayat?

The current Sarpanch (elected head) of Kotara Gram Panchayat is SMT SEWATI DEVI SARTHI.

4. Who is the Secretary of Kotara Gram Panchayat?

The Secretary of Kotara Gram Panchayat is GOVINDA PARHI.

5. What is the postal PIN code of Kotara Gram Panchayat?

The PIN code of Kotara Gram Panchayat is 496554.

6. Which villages are part of Kotara Gram Panchayat?

Kotara Gram Panchayat includes the following villages: Bikrampali, Eripali, Kosamdih, Kotara.

7. What is the name of the Tehsil under which Kotara Gram Panchayat falls?

Kotara Gram Panchayat falls under Baramkela Tehsil in Sarangarh-bilaigarh District.
